Prince William ready to take major risks for the monarchy as the king gives in

Prince William has made great strides behind palace gates to confront the ongoing challenges that have been a nightmare for the royal family.

King Charles is said to have delegated responsibilities to the Prince of Wales, knowing full well that William would one day take over the monarchy. Even if this does not erase the fact that there is a major conflict of approach between the monarch and his heir.

The royal family is currently dealing with the fallout from Andrew Mountbatten-Windsor’s scandals and his links to pedophile Jeffery Epstein. If William’s cousins, Beatrice and Eugenie, also face an uncertain future, Prince Harry and Meghan Markle are also on the future king’s agenda.

“William isn’t afraid to make tough decisions,” a source told reporter Rob Shuter. “And right now, that’s exactly what the royal family needs.”

The source stressed that the monarchy is under “more pressure than ever” and that the royal family needs someone who can make “difficult and unpopular decisions”, even if it comes at a heavy price.

“He understands the issues,” the source added. “It’s not just a family, it’s a business.”

William is aware of all the problems, especially those caused by his blood relatives, and he acts accordingly. “He’s not trying to be liked. He’s trying to protect the monarchy.”

According to William’s friends, there is a contrast between father and son. Charles “leads with his heart” and William “leads with strategy”.

Royal experts have claimed the Prince of Wales has a “ruthless” approach and “does not forget or forgive easily”.

“If you cross the line, that’s it.”

Even though Charles is still the king, he understands that William will take the reins in the future. Therefore, although he held authority, he made William a large part of every decision made.
